Cilantro Restaurant and Wine Bar – MiCasa All Suite Hotel, KL Malaysia

If you are looking for a nice romantic quiet fine dining place, this is it. I simply love the clean elegance of this place. Not to mention, their staff are super friendly and always approach our table with a big smile. Hence, this was our first pick to celebrate our Anniversary.

Over the years, this restaurant has never fail to serve good quality consistent taste meal. (Can’t say it’s the same for the portion – I remember it was a much bigger serving previously. Personally, I don’t really mind with the smaller portion as long as the quality is still there).

Customary bread and truffle butter (I still think Cilantro serves the BEST truffle butter in all the restaurant I’ve been to). Followed by the Amuse bouche.

A lot of people will be shock when they see how my family eats western food, but, I think it’s a much more interesting way. We ordered 3 sets of the 4 course meal to share between the 4 of us. That way, we get to taste everything! I Love the appetizers in Cilantro and we had 6 plates of it! (yay… jumping with joy).

Like i say… I LOVE their appetizer. How can you not? Look at it !!! It’s fantastic. My favourite would have to be the Risotto and the Wagyu Tartare.

Milk Fed Lamb Rack with Houba Miso Confit of Loire Poussin with Truffle 02 2 Way Preparation Wagyu with Asparagus 02Yes – the portion is surprisingly small for mains. I am quite surprise as I remember it used to be more than this. Anyway, good news is the taste is still good. My favourite would have to be the spring chicken (poussin).
